Inter President Steven Zhang has denied reports that Inter are up for sale by owners Suning.

Speaking to Italian broadcaster Sky Sport Italia, the President addressed the recent reports about the Nerazzurri’s future, and also emphasized that the club are extremely keen to keep hold of defender Milan Skriniar.

Reports over the past week or so have cast a great deal of doubt over the future of Suning as Inter owners.

The owners’ ability to keep control of the club on a financial level has been questioned throughout the past couple years, but the Chinese company have always filtered out that they are not looking for anything more than minority partners.

This was the point that Zhang continued to make, despite recent reports that emerged suggesting that the owners have asked US-based investment banks Goldman Sachs and Raine Group to look for outright buyers.

“Over the past 3-4 years the club has been, and still is, at the centre of all sorts of speculation,” Zhang said.

“We have to focus on ourselves,” he continued.

The President made clear that “I’m not talking to any investors, the club is not for sale.”

Of the qualification for the Champions League knockouts after beating Viktoria Plzen, Zhang said that “Today we’ve achieved an important result.”

“No one could have imagined this six years ago,” he continued.

“Everyone wants to see Inter at their best.”

“Apart from this qualification for the round of sixteen we’ve won three trophies,” Zhang noted.

“This shows that the choices that have been made have been the right ones for the club.”

“Every year we’ve increased what this team is capable of, and we’re constantly working towards improving, never satisfied,” Zhang said.

“Today we proved that we’re a winning team on and off the pitch,” he continued.

Zhang praised the team and coach Simone Inzaghi, stating that “Our coach and the players are doing very well.”

“The work we’ve done over the last 4-6 years has all been done to make the club better,” he continued.

“And we’ve noticed the improvement.”

Zhang backed the coach, stating that “Inzaghi is a top coach, very resilient despite all the difficulties football throws at him, he’s always able to overcome them.”

“We’ve seen all these qualities.”

“Progressing to the next round is good news for the future of the club,” Zhang said.

Of the transfer rumours and future of defender Skriniar, Zhang said that “Every summer, every year, everyone can see that we’re trying to improve the squad.”

“And this summer as well we’ve tried to make the team competitive.”

“Skriniar is an incredible player,” the president said, “he knows how much I care about him and I’m confident that we’ll be able to keep hold of him.”
